Title: Innovator Spotlight: Tomer Elran
Introduction: Tomer Elran, hailing from Petah Tikva, Israel, is an accomplished inventor with a remarkable portfolio of seven patents. His innovations primarily focus on electrostatic discharge protection circuits and signal decoding techniques, contributing significantly to the field of electronics.
Latest Patents: Tomer's most recent patents showcase his ingenuity and technical prowess. One of his latest inventions is an "ESD protection circuit with two discharge time periods." This circuit addresses the critical challenge of managing electrostatic discharge events by utilizing discharge path circuitry that operates during two distinct timing windows. The initial period allows for the suppression of ESD voltage, while the second timing window ensures continued protection against lingering effects of the discharge.
Additionally, he has developed "systems, circuitry, and methods for decoding pulse width modulated signals." This patent describes an innovative approach that involves a pair of charge modules and a voltage comparison module to accurately decode PWM signals. This technology is vital for efficient control in various electronic applications.
Career Highlights: Throughout his career, Tomer has made significant contributions while working at prominent companies, including SanDisk Technologies Inc. and SanDisk IL Ltd.
